Pep Guardiola has reiterated that Aymeric Laporte will be out for five or six months, while John Stones will be out for a month.

No other concerns. we will see how the players feel before making the selection tomorrow.

Pep Guardiola on the defence: "I said we don’t have many other options. Two young players we trust a lot. Eric [Garcia] is training last season with us. Harwood-Bellis trained in pre-season and we will count on them..."
 
Pep Guardiola: "I spoke with Mikel and Rodo and my staff [after Norwich]. They help me to find the best solution for what happened. After watching the game, I wasn't upset with the way we played. I was upset against Newcastle [last season]."

Pep Guardiola on losing: "I lose many times. The only way to survive is to win and we have won a lot. That’s a consequence of what can improve. What you’ve done in the past does not mean you can do it in the future..."
 
Pep Guardiola on the FA Cup final last season: "We played knowing we could be part of something unique in English football history. We played in that position and had a few problems at the beginning. We were relaxed and won the Premier League..."

"Now it’s totally different, it’s the beginning of the season and they have changed their manager. I saw their game against Arsenal and the second half was incredible the way they played..."

Pep Guardiola on Gabriel Jesus: "Maybe he will be involved tomorrow. He's an incredible player. His behaviour in training sessions is incredible. He has to fight for a position with a legend [Sergio] but he accepts it. My praise for him is over the moon."

"With Gabriel I say 'just be patient'. When he plays, I know he does absolutely everything. He's a young striker with an incredible future for this club."
